Key Stages of a State College Kitchen Remodel
Understanding the typical stages involved in a kitchen remodel can help homeowners in State College navigate the process with greater confidence. Each step is crucial for a successful outcome, ensuring your renovation aligns with your vision and budget.
Planning and Design
This is arguably the most critical phase. It involves defining your needs, desires, and budget. Local kitchen remodeling professionals in State College will work with you to:
- Assess your current kitchen’s layout and identify areas for improvement.
- Discuss your cooking habits, entertaining style, and storage requirements.
- Explore different design styles that complement your home’s architecture, whether it’s a colonial-style home or a more modern build.
- Select materials for cabinetry, countertops, flooring, and backsplashes, considering durability, aesthetics, and cost.
- Create detailed floor plans and 3D renderings to visualize the final look.
- Obtain necessary permits and understand local building codes in State College.
Demolition and Preparation
Once the design is finalized and permits are secured, the old kitchen is carefully dismantled. This involves removing cabinets, countertops, flooring, fixtures, and sometimes even walls to create a blank canvas for the renovation. Structural considerations, such as load-bearing walls or plumbing and electrical rerouting, are addressed during this stage.
Installation and Construction
This phase brings the design to life. New cabinetry is installed, followed by plumbing and electrical rough-ins for appliances and fixtures. Countertops are then fitted, and backsplash materials are applied. Flooring is laid, and then the final finishes, such as appliance installation, lighting fixtures, and hardware, are completed.
Finishing Touches and Inspection
The final stages involve painting, caulking, and any other minor aesthetic adjustments. A thorough inspection is conducted to ensure all work meets quality standards and local building codes. The contractor will then walk you through your new kitchen, addressing any final questions or concerns.

Kitchen Flooring Installation
The right kitchen flooring in State College needs to withstand heavy foot traffic, spills, and the general wear and tear of daily life, all while contributing to the overall design. Popular options often include durable and water-resistant materials like luxury vinyl plank (LVP), tile, and hardwood. LVP is a favored choice for its resilience, affordability, and wide array of realistic wood-look finishes. Ceramic or porcelain tile offers excellent durability and a vast selection of styles. Professional flooring installers ensure a level subfloor, proper material application, and a seamless finish that enhances both the beauty and longevity of your kitchen.

Kitchen Layout and Design Improvements
Optimizing your kitchen’s layout is crucial for both functionality and flow. Many State College homes can benefit from thoughtful design improvements that create a more efficient workspace and enhance social interaction. This might involve reconfiguring the “kitchen triangle” (sink, stove, refrigerator) for better workflow, expanding an island for more prep or seating space, or improving lighting to reduce shadows and create a brighter atmosphere. What is the average cost of a kitchen remodel in State College?
The cost of a kitchen remodel in State College can vary significantly based on the scope of the project, the materials chosen, and the contractor’s rates. A minor refresh, such as new cabinet fronts and a backsplash, might range from $10,000 to $25,000. A mid-range remodel, involving new cabinets, countertops, flooring, and some appliance upgrades, could fall between $25,000 and $75,000. A high-end, full-scale renovation, including layout changes, premium materials, and top-of-the-line appliances, can exceed $75,000 and potentially reach $150,000 or more. It’s essential to get detailed quotes from multiple local contractors to establish an accurate budget for your specific project.
How long does a typical kitchen remodel take in State College?
The duration of a kitchen remodel in State College depends on the project’s complexity. A straightforward cosmetic update might take a couple of weeks. However, a more comprehensive renovation that involves structural changes, extensive plumbing, or electrical work can typically take anywhere from 6 to 12 weeks, or sometimes longer. Factors like the availability of materials, the efficiency of the chosen contractor, and any unforeseen issues that may arise during the renovation process can also influence the timeline. Open communication with your contractor about the expected schedule is crucial.
